Output d8b5ac1ecc403c2d2744b06f3d39c7b5b06daa0fbce984deeb8ab63efde21372:40

value
132880309
script pubkey
OP_0 OP_PUSHBYTES_20 40e4258173896b7c58ea72d07d60143e805bdc5c
address
bc1qgrjztqtn394hck82wtg86cq586q9hhzuc4z9fg
transaction
d8b5ac1ecc403c2d2744b06f3d39c7b5b06daa0fbce984deeb8ab63efde21372
confirmations
274831
spent
true